Abstract

An applicator brush for liquid or pasty media, especially for decorative cosmetics such as mascara. The brush comprises a rod-shaped support ( ) which is provided with a plurality of injection-molded projections ( ) on the outside thereof. The projections ( ) are made of synthetic material, protrude radially in different directions and are arranged at a mutual distance from each other. The aim of the invention is to reliably obtain a good combing effect and equal appliance of the means to be applied. To this end, the projections ( ) are provided with a cross-section which tapers towards the free end of the projections ( ). The projections ( ) and the support ( ) are made from a flexible synthetic material, especially an elastomeric synthetic material.
